Buying Guide for Inline Fuel Pump for Fuel Injection
Understanding Inline Fuel Pumps
When I first started looking into inline fuel pumps for fuel injection systems, I quickly realized how crucial they are for engine performance. Inline fuel pumps are designed to provide a consistent fuel supply to the fuel injectors, ensuring optimal engine operation. They are typically used in fuel-injected engines, where precise fuel delivery is essential for efficiency and power.
Types of Inline Fuel Pumps
In my research, I discovered that there are different types of inline fuel pumps, each suited for various applications. I found that they can be categorized into two main types: electric and mechanical. Electric pumps are popular for their efficiency and ease of installation. Mechanical pumps, on the other hand, are often found in older vehicles and are driven by the engine’s motion.
Considerations Before Buying
Before purchasing an inline fuel pump, I learned to consider several important factors. First, I needed to know the fuel flow rate required by my engine. This is typically measured in gallons per hour (GPH) or liters per hour (LPH). Additionally, I had to check the pump’s pressure rating to ensure it matched my fuel injection system’s specifications.
Compatibility with Fuel Type
I realized that compatibility with fuel type is crucial. Some pumps are designed specifically for gasoline, while others can handle diesel or alcohol-based fuels. I made sure to choose a pump that matched the fuel type used in my vehicle to avoid any potential issues.
